POTENSI BAKTERI KITINOLITIK DALAM PENGENDALIAN Aspergillus niger PENYEBAB PENYAKIT BUSUK PANGKAL AKAR PADA TANAMAN KACANG TANAH
Abstract: A study of
chitinolytic bacteria ability to control Aspergillus niger, a causal agent of
basal root rot of peanut seedlings
was conducted in
Pest and Disease
Laboratory, Medan Johor
and Laboratory of
Microbiology, Department of Biology, Faculty of Mathematics and Natural
Sciences, University of Sumatera Utara, Medan.
The purpose of
study is to
evaluate the ability
of Bacillus sp.
BK13, Enterobacter sp.
BK15, Bacillus sp. BK17, Enterobacter cloacae LK08, Bacillus
sp. KR05, and Enterobacter sp. PB17 to inhibit the growth of A. niger on the
peanut seedling. Antagonistic test
showed that the most effective bacteria in inhibiting the growth of A. niger
was BK15 isolate with inhibition zone of 2,88 cm and BK13 isolate with inhibition
zone of 2,69 cm,
whereas the least
effective bacteria was
BK17, with inhibition
zone of 2,30
cm. Chitinolytic bacterial isolates
used to cover
peanut seed through
soaking enabled to
reduce seed basal
root rot. BK15 isolate
showed potential to
reduce the basal
root rot by
58,82% while the
lowest inhibition was
BK13 by 47,06%.
